While your dog may not be able to tell you that they are feeling unusually chilly, they definitely can experience chills! A dog may shake uncontrollably before an episode of sickness likely diarrhea or vomiting. Chills that won't go away may indicate that the illness is more serious, and a trip to the vet is needed. WebNov 3, 2024 · Dog flu cases range from mild to severe and, unlike human influenzas, are not seasonal. Keep an eye out for the following … WebJan 14, 2024 · An infection of the respiratory tract can be caused by viruses and bacteria. The symptoms are similar to respiratory infections in people with sneezing, a runny nose, cough and possibly a fever. Most cases are self-limiting. However, in more severe cases, a dog may develop pneumonia. An example of an infection that can lead to cold …
